Full-Stack Engineer
Overview
A global enterprise organisation is looking to hire a Full Stack Engineer / Technical Lead to drive the design and delivery of an internal AI-enabled platform focused on workflow automation and support operations.
This role blends hands-on engineering with technical leadership, owning delivery across frontend, backend, APIs, and AI-driven workflows at scale.
The Opportunity
You will lead the build of an end-to-end internal platform used by employees to manage workflows, automate tasks, and enhance operational efficiency.
This includes designing and implementing AI-powered workflows (e.g. automated support, task resolution, and intelligent routing) integrated with enterprise systems.
Key Responsibilities
Technical Leadership & Architecture
- Define end-to-end architecture across frontend, backend, APIs, and AI-driven workflows
- Make architectural decisions aligned with enterprise standards and best practices
- Mentor engineers and provide hands-on technical guidance
- Ensure performance, scalability, security, and resilience
Full Stack Engineering
- Build user-facing applications for internal users and support teams
- Develop backend services, APIs, and workflow engines
- Design and implement AI-powered workflows using LLMs
- Build features such as chat interfaces, task automation, and case management
- Implement guardrails, error handling, fallback logic, and human-in-the-loop processes
Delivery Ownership
- Own delivery from design through to deployment
- Work with product and business stakeholders to define requirements
- Lead agile ceremonies and delivery planning
- Manage risks, dependencies, and technical challenges
Integration & Platform Enablement
- Integrate with enterprise systems (e.g. identity, ITSM, collaboration tools)
- Implement secure authentication, RBAC, and auditing
- Support production release and operational readiness
Governance & Stakeholder Communication
- Ensure compliance with internal governance and security standards
- Communicate decisions and progress to technical and non-technical stakeholders
- Contribute to engineering best practices
Core Requirements
- Strong full stack development experience (frontend + backend)
- Proficiency in Python, Node.js, or Java
- Experience building production-grade APIs and web applications
- Experience leading technical delivery in agile environments
- Strong API design, system design, and architectural skills
- Understanding of LLM APIs, prompt engineering, and AI workflows
- Strong knowledge of security, authentication, and secure coding
- Experience working in enterprise or regulated environments
Preferred Experience
- Experience integrating with ITSM tools (e.g. ServiceNow, Jira, Zendesk)
- Experience with collaboration platforms (e.g. Slack, Teams)
- Experience building internal platforms or enterprise tools
- Exposure to financial services or regulated industries
- Experience with cloud-native architectures and CI/CD
Working Model
- Hybrid working (typically 3 days on-site)
Compensation
- Competitive contract rate
- Flexible depending on scope and experience